H2: How to Prevent Soap Scum Buildup in the Future
Use Liquid Soap Instead of Bar Soap – Bar soaps contain fatty acids that contribute to buildup.
Install a Water Softener – Reduces mineral content in your water.
Wipe Down Your Bathtub After Every Use – A quick dry with a towel prevents residue formation.
Use a DIY Daily Spray:
Mix equal parts vinegar and water in a spray bottle.
Lightly spray after each shower or bath.
H2: FAQs – Answering Your Soap Scum Cleaning Questions
H3: What is the fastest way to remove soap scum from a bathtub?
The vinegar and baking soda method is the fastest and most effective way to break down stubborn soap scum.

H3: Can I use bleach to clean soap scum?
While bleach is great for disinfecting, it’s not very effective at breaking down soap scum. Vinegar or lemon work better.

H3: Does hot water help remove soap scum?
Yes! Warm water softens the residue, making it easier to scrub off.
